ELECTROBEAT CREW
Founded: 1984
Group Members: Dave Storrs, Ice T, Kid Frost, Henry G & Evil E, Chris "The Glove" Taylor
The Electrobeat Crew never released a record toghether as a group, but all members of the Crew raised huge success. The Solo Releases from the Artist on Dave Storrs Label Electrobeat changed LA Rap forever and gave them the base to start their carreers. Ice T innovated Gangsta Rap, Chris "The Glove" Taylor became a successfull producer and worked on titles like the "The Chronic" Album by Dr. Dre.
The Electrobeat Crew were involved in the Movies Breakin, Breakin 2 (Electric Boogaloo) and Rappin with Mario Van Peebles. In Rappin Ice T, Dave Storrs & Henry G are doin a Live Performance of "Killers", which was released on Electrobeat Records. The biggest success the Electrobeat Crew had with the song "Reckless" on Polydor Records from the Movie Breakin.
The Movie Breakin basicly has the same staff which appeared in the Rainbow TV Documentation "Breaking & Entering". After Electrobeat Records Dave Storrs started the short living Label Nightbeat Records, which had the two Releases. Bronx Style Bob with "Bob-Didi-Bob / N.Y. Ninja" and "Mysterious Waves" by Kosmic Light Force.
